Ginger & chilli salmon in a parcel

Unwrap the parcel at the table and for an aromatic assault on the senses

Difficulty and servings

Easy

Serves 2

Preperation and cooking times

Ready in 20 mins

Method

  1. Heat the oven to 200C/fan 180C/gas 6. Put each salmon steak in the middle of a piece of baking parchment or foil. Put some ginger and spring onion on top of each and then add a few drops of soy sauce and chilli oil.
  2. Fold the parchment into parcels around the fish, put on a baking sheet and cook in the oven for 10 minutes. Open the parcels, sprinkle over some coriander and serve with rice.

Gi assessment

Basmati rice scores low to medium on the Gi scales, similar to brown rice. Add lots of veg or salad for an even slower rise in blood sugar.

Per serving

283 kcalories, protein 28.6g, carbohydrate 0.7g, fat 18.5 g, saturated fat 3.5g, fibre 0.1g, salt 0.7 g
